Among patients with new-onset urticaria, 75% recovered within a week, whereas 17% progressed to chronic urticaria, and higher age at onset, elevated BMI, and early prednisolone use were associated ... Hives (Urticaria) is an itchy rash caused by tiny amounts of fluid that leak from blood vessels under the skin, normally fades within a day.
